Camping trip cancelled with 2 weeks notice by host - but this was because the HipCamp calendar didn't synch up, so they were double booked. I contacted Hipcamp, and after 2 weeks still haven't heard back from them. The host was very apologestic when I contacted them directly, but the error was Hipcamp's fault. I've also not had a refund through, and have had to ask the host to chase Hipcamp up.

HipCamp charges exorbitant fees to hipcampers -close to 20% and that is on top of the 10% that is charged to the Host. If you decide to change your dates, even within the Host cancellation policy guidelines, you will be charged even more. On a $455.40 bill , we were charged $208.79 in fees by HipCamp because we changed the dates. That is almost 50% of our bill. I followed up but only received canned responses from their customer support center which took days to get back to me. We will never book with them again. Buyer beware. If you look them up on BBB they are not accredited and received an F rating with many complaints.
